There’s no better way to ease into summer than by taking a full moon kayak tour in Arkansas! One of the more underrated floating streams, the Cadron Creek, will be the setting for a fascinating tour under the moon. Let’s decorate our canoes in LEDs and see what all this event entails.
Have you taken a full moon kayak tour before? Outfitters like Cadron Creek and a handful of Arkansas State Parks host these fun nighttime events!
